The majority race in Indian River Estates overall is white, making up 86.6% of residents. The next most-common racial group is hispanic at 6.6%. There are more white people in the south areas of the city. People who identify as hispanic are most likely to be living in the northwest places. Diversity and Diversity Scores for Indian River Estates, FL
The map below shows diversity in Indian River Estates. Areas in green are more diverse, while areas in red are much less diverse. Diversity, in this case, means a mixture of people with different race and ethnicity living close to one another. For example, all-black and all-white areas in the city would both be considered lacking diversity.
Diversity Score
Indian River Estates Diversity Score
63
With a diversity score of 63 out of 100, Indian River Estates is more diverse than other US cities. The most diverse area within Indian River Estates's proper boundaries is to the northeast of the city. The least diverse areas are located in the south parts of Indian River Estates.
